This year I have two folded christmas cards available of two of my original watercolour paintings.
The first card is a night scene from my village Eglwysbach, in Wales, in the depths of winter. I was inspired by the glimmering frost, the huddling sheep, and the clear cold sky with the drifting smoke coming from the cottage. It is called "Earth Stood Hard As Iron".

The second was inspired by Inishowen, in Donegal, and shows a thoroughly ruined cottage, that would once have been a farmers abode. In reality, the vast hill behind it totally dwarfs the house, and only adds to the drama of a winter blizzard sweeping down from the north. It is called "In The Bleak Mid Winter".
The cards are printed on high quality paper and come with envelopes. They are available at £10 for a pack of 4 large cards, or £10 for a pack of 5 small cards (plus postage and packing). I can make a pack up of any combination of one or both cards.
